Andy Roddick faces fellow American James Blake in an all-American semi-final clash at the AEGON Championships at Queen's late Saturday afternoon.

Head-to-head stats give Andy Roddick the advantage, leading James Blake 6-2. The second seed Roddick last defeated the sixth seed Blake at the 2005 tournament in Washington, notching a 7-5, 6-3 victory in the finals.

Roddick has moved into the semi-finals of Queen's with relative ease, dismissing each opponent in straight sets. The rejuvinated 26-year-old Roddick defeated Ivo Karlovic with a 7-6, 7-6 win in the quarterfinals.

Roddick hopes to remain on course to take home his fifth career Queen’s Club championship and second ATP World Tour title of the year. Roddick took home top honors at the AEGON Championships in 2003, 2004, 2005 and again in 2007.

Blake made an improved performance in the quarterfinals Friday evening, besting tricky opponent and 14th seed Mikhail Youzhny of Russia, 7-6, 6-3.
